LoadThe concept of load is related to the peed and nature of the information flow. The problem of under load arises where the speed of communication and nature of the information is slow that it leads to dissatisfaction. Whereas the problem of overload arises when the flow of information is so great in quality and complexity or both that the system cannot handle it.
PerceptionThe perceptual process determines what messages we select or screen out as well as how the selected information is organized and interpreted. This can be a significant source of noise in the communication process if the perceptions of the sender and receiver aren't aligned.
FilteringSome messages are filtered or stopped altogether on their way up, down, or along the hierarchy. Filtering may involve deleting or delaying negative information or editing them to sound more favorable. Employees and supervisors sometimes filter information to display a better impression of them, which may even result in distortion of the said information.

Communication challenges can arise from various factors, such as language barriers, where individuals struggle to understand each other due to different languages or jargon. Cultural differences can also lead to misunderstandings, as norms and expressions vary across cultures. Additionally, emotional barriers, such as stress or anxiety, can hinder effective communication, making it difficult for individuals to express themselves clearly. Lastly, technological issues, like poor connectivity during virtual meetings, can disrupt the flow of communication.
Internal communication challenges often include information silos, lack of clarity, and differing communication styles among team members, which can lead to misunderstandings and decreased collaboration. External communication difficulties may involve managing brand consistency, navigating cultural differences, and responding to diverse audience needs. Both internal and external communication can be hindered by technological barriers and the rapid pace of information flow, which can overwhelm or confuse stakeholders. Effective strategies are essential to address these challenges and foster clear, consistent messaging.
